Cetacea - Wikipedia Cetaceans are famous for their high intelligence, complex social behaviour, and the enormous size of some of the group's members For example, the blue whale reaches a maximum confirmed length of 29 9 meters (98 feet) and a weight of 173 tonnes (190 short tons), making it the largest animal ever known to have existed
Cetacean | Life Span, Evolution, Characteristics | Britannica cetacean, (order Cetacea), any member of an entirely aquatic group of mammals commonly known as whales, dolphins, and porpoises The ancient Greeks recognized that cetaceans breathe air, give birth to live young, produce milk, and have hair —all features of mammals

What is a cetacean? - Whale Dolphin Conservation USA Cetacean is the collective noun used to describe all 90 species of whales, dolphins and porpoises The word cetacean has its origins in Latin (Cetus) referring to a large sea creature and Greek (Ketos) meaning whale or sea monster

All you need to know about cetaceans - Azores Whales What is a cetacean? Cetaceans are whales, dolphins and porpoises Cetaceans are mammals which means they breathe air, give birth to live young (underwater unlike seals who give birth on land) and suckle their calves
